Chicopee- James E. Sheehan, 89, passed away peacefully on January 14, 2021.  He was the son of the late James J. and Bridget M. (Collins) Sheehan, immigrants from West Kerry, Ireland.  Raised in the Hungry Hill neighborhood of Springfield, Jim attended Our Lady of Hope School and graduated from Cathedral High School with the Class of 1950.  He served honorably in the U.S. Army during the Korean War, worked as a master plumber at Holyoke Valve and Hydrant and Baystate Medical Center.  Jim was an active member of Holy Name Parish in Chicopee, as well as the John Boyle O'Reilly Club and the Knights of Columbus Council #69.  Jim was predeceased by his wife, Ann Marie (Gill) Sheehan in 2015, and by his sisters Theresa and Mary Sheehan, Margaret Phelon, Helen Bailey, and Claire Tippet.  He leaves behind his sons, James J. Sheehan, of Chicopee, Daniel E. Sheehan of Westfield, Michael K. Sheehan and his wife, Angela, of Mason, OH, and Kevin T. Sheehan and his wife, Cheryl, of Burlington, MA, as well as his grandsons, Jack and Tommy Sheehan.  Calling hours will be held on Tuesday, January 19, 2021, from 4 to 7p.m. at Corridan Funeral Home, 333 Springfield St., Chicopee.  Friends and family are invited to gather directly at Holy Name Parish, 94 Springfield St., Chicopee, at 10a.m. on Wednesday, January 20, for a Liturgy of Christian Burial, followed by committal with military honors in Calvary Cemetery.  All those in attendance are required to wear a face mask and please abide by social distancing guidelines.  In lieu of flowers, donations can be made in Jim's memory to Holy Name Parish, 104 Springfield St., Chicopee, MA 01013.  To share a memory or leave your condolences, please visit www.CorridanFuneral.com
